Edward D. Baca
1938–2020 (age 82)
U.S. Army lieutenant general
Biography
Edward D. Baca dedicated his life to guiding soldiers and improving readiness as he rose through the ranks of the U.S. Army, culminating in his service as a lieutenant general. He balanced the demands of command with a steady focus on mentorship, ensuring young leaders were prepared to meet the challenges of their generation while honoring the traditions of the Army.
A New Mexico native, he maintained deep roots in Santa Fe, championing education for military families and encouraging civic partnerships. He is laid to rest at Santa Fe National Cemetery, where his example of service continues to inspire those who visit.
